# Approvals: Password Reset Revamp

Hey reviewer — the new Fennelgate reset flow swaps emailed links for short-lived codes with rate limiting per account and per device. Threat model doc is linked in the sidebar; red-team notes from the Harrowick office are attached. Sign-off requires two approvals, and the accountable owner is named directly below.

account owner for fajep-yagef: Kasix Eliiel

Subject: Handover — donation-receipt mailer

Welcome aboard. As part of the reshuffle at Bellgrove Trustworks, ownership of the Tithely receipt mailer is changing hands this week. The mailer generates annual donation receipts, batches them nightly, and retries failed sends up to three times; the templates live in `mailer/receipts/`. Please route all questions about queue behavior, template edits, or retry policy through the new owner rather than the old alias. Effective Monday, responsibility transfers to the person named below.

account owner for tawef-yadug: Jorius Normir Silath

## Support

Tilebarrow (our map-tile prefetcher) is maintained by the Wayfinder platform squad, so don't panic if prefetch queues stall — it's usually the cache eviction job hogging disk. Check the `prefetch-status` dashboard first, then the known-issues page. For weird stuff like corrupted tile bundles or region manifests that won't load, just drop us a line at the squad inbox.

escalation mailbox, bafog-fafog: ulador@paliqlabs.internal

Subject: Compaction fix rolling out to MsgHollow brokers

Team, ahead of the weekly sync: the log compaction patch for MsgHollow is cleared for staged rollout. It resolves the segment-merge deadlock that inflated disk usage on the Thornbeck cluster. We verified compaction lag returns to baseline within two cycles and that no tombstones are dropped early. Canary begins Tuesday. For auditing, the deploy corresponds to the build identified below.

build token for kagaf-hahof: htk14_9d3d4d26d7d8de